Generation of Phosphoranes Derived from Phosphites. A New Class of Phosphorus Ylides Leading to High E Selectivity with Semi-stabilizing Groups in Wittig Olefinations

Abstract

Aryl tosylhydrazones react with t-BuOK, ClFeTPP, (MeO)3P, and aldehydes to furnish olefins with high E selectivity through a Wittig-type pathway via the corresponding diazo compounds, metal carbenes and phosphorous ylides. A Horner-Wadsworth-Emmons-type reaction of ethyl diazoacetate with aldehydes occurs with high E selectivity in the presence of LiBr via the phosphonate anion, formed through an Arbuzov reaction under completely base-free conditions.
